Cherry Lemon-Ricotta Trifle

Cherry Lemon-Ricotta Trifle Ingredients
  • 2 cans (21 oz. each) cherry pie filling
  • 1 cup cherry preserves
  • 4 cups ricotta cheese
  • 1 cup sugar
  • 1⁄4 cup Limón cello liqueur
  • 1 Tbsp. lemon juice
  • 2 tsps. Vanilla extract
  • 2 containers (8 oz. each) frozen whipped topping, thawed
  • 6 large purchased croissants
Cherry Lemon-Ricotta Trifle Directions

1. In medium bowl, combine cherry pie filling and cherry preserves; set aside.
2. In large bowl, stir together ricotta cheese, sugar, Limón cello, lemon juice, and vanilla. Stir in whipped topping.
3. Tear croissants into bite-size pieces and place half in the bottom of trifle dish.
Spoon half of the ricotta mixture on top of croissants. Spoon half of cherry mixture on top of ricotta mixture. Repeat with remaining ingredients to make another layer.
4. Refrigerate trifle until ready to serve (up to 8 hours).

Start to Finish 25 minutes

Yield: 16 servings.
